Salers Aperitif


No images

A classic French Aperitif from a recipe dating back to 1885. It is made with a secret recipe of herbs, bittered with Gentiane root from the Auvergne region and mellowed in Limousin oak The result is a bittersweet, earthy, a touch vegetal with notes of anise and citrus. It is traditionally enjoyed over ice with a twist of lemon but can be used in a variety of cocktails.
